What Is a Gastrointestinal Health Specialist?
A gastrointestinal health specialist, often referred to as a gastroenterologist, is a medical doctor who has completed extensive education and training in the field of digestive health. These specialists are skilled in identifying and treating a broad range of conditions affecting the gastrointestinal tract, including the esophagus, stomach, intestines, liver, pancreas, and gallbladder. Their expertise allows them to perform diagnostic procedures like endoscopies and colonoscopies, ensuring accurate diagnosis and effective treatment plans.
Common Gastrointestinal Disorders and Their Treatments
There are numerous gastrointestinal disorders that can significantly impact an individual's life. Here are some of the most common conditions treated by a gastrointestinal health specialist:
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S)
IBS is a functional GI disorder characterized by symptoms such as abdominal pain, bloating, and altered bowel habits (diarrhea, constipation, or both). While the exact cause is not fully understood, treatment often involves dietary changes, stress management, and, in some cases, medications to alleviate symptoms.
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D)
GERD is a chronic condition where stomach acid frequently flows back into the esophagus, leading to heartburn and other uncomfortable symptoms. Lifestyle modifications, such as weight loss, dietary changes, and avoiding specific triggers, are usually recommended. In more severe cases, medications or surgery may be necessary.
Crohn's Disease
Crohn's disease is an inflammatory bowel disease that can affect any part of the GI tract but most commonly impacts the intestines. Symptoms include abdominal pain, severe diarrhea, fatigue, and weight loss. Treatment varies based on severity and may include anti-inflammatory medications, immune system suppressors, or surgery for severe cases.
When to See a Gastrointestinal Health Specialist
Recognizing when to seek help from a gastrointestinal health specialist is essential for effective management of digestive issues. Here are some red flags to watch for:
- Persistent abdominal pain that does not improve over time
- Significant changes in bowel habits, such as prolonged diarrhea or constipation
- Unintended weight loss
- Blood in the stool or dark, tarry stools
- Difficulty swallowing or persistent heartburn
If you experience any of these symptoms, it’s important to consult with a specialist as soon as possible. Early intervention can prevent complications and lead to better health outcomes.
Maintaining Gastrointestinal Health
Beyond seeking treatment for existing conditions, maintaining gastrointestinal health is vital for everyone. Here are some tips to promote a healthy digestive system:
- Eat a balanced diet rich in fiber, fruits, and vegetables
-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day
- Engage in regular physical activity to promote healthy digestion
- Avoid smoking and limit alcohol consumption
- Manage stress through mindfulness, yoga, or other relaxation techniques
